I don't think we should adopt an attitude of the form "If it isn't
Gnome, it sucks", but better integration with Gnome is a good thing.
And some Gnome dialogs might be substantially more convenient than the
current Emacs facilities.  Thus, supporting the Gnome dialogs might be
an improvement in general, as well as an improvement in coherence.
